**Gisele Bündchen Reflects on Gratitude and New Family Life After Welcoming Baby Boy**

Supermodel Gisele Bündchen has shared a candid update on her life, months after expanding her family with partner Joaquim Valente. The Brazilian fashion icon, 44, gave birth to a baby boy in February, marking a new chapter in her life after nearly two years of dating Valente.

In an exclusive cover story for French Vogue, Bündchen revealed how she has been adjusting to life with her new baby and balancing her rejuvenated professional pursuits. "Now that my little one is sleeping through the night, I'm back in control of my routine," she told the publication, acknowledging the profound impact of sleep—or the lack thereof—on her daily life.

Though Bündchen has yet to disclose her son’s first name, it was reported that his middle name is River. The new addition to her family comes alongside her responsibilities to her two elder children, Benjamin and Vivian, from her previous marriage to retired NFL star Tom Brady. Bündchen and Brady divorced in October 2022 following nearly 14 years of marriage.

Expressing a deep sense of gratitude, Bündchen said, "Being able to be home with my kids and enjoy every moment with them is priceless." She opened up about her life post-pregnancy, sharing that she has a "clearer understanding of my priorities" and feels "more comfortable in my own skin."

Bündchen’s interview also marks her return to the fashion world. "It's nice to see everyone again after this break," she shared, adding humorously that getting her hair and makeup done feels like a vacation. "With a baby, the nights are so short that I've barely brushed my hair in the last few months!"

This heartfelt share offers a glimpse into the supermodel’s personal and professional life as she navigates motherhood once again, emphasizing the joys and challenges that come with it.
